Your new role
You will join a high-performing team as a SQL Database Administrator, acting as a subject-matter expert across both Azure and on-premise Microsoft SQL Server and MySQL environments.
This role will see you supporting enterprise-scale database platforms across production, UAT and development environments, ensuring optimal performance, availability and security.
Due to the nature of the environment, this position is based full-time on-site within a secure facility in Manchester.
What you'll be doing
- Administering and maintaining MS SQL Server and MySQL databases
- Managing clustering, replication, backups and performance tuning
- Providing 3rd line support and resolving incidents via call management systems
- Delivering planned releases, patches and upgrades across environments
- Monitoring and optimising database performance, including storage and alerting
- Supporting space management and proactive system health checks
- Mentoring junior DBAs and contributing to wider team knowledge sharing
What you'll need to succeed
- Strong experience with Microsoft SQL Server (2016 onwards)
- Advanced knowledge of T-SQL, stored procedures and triggers
- Experience working with Azure VMs, Windows Server and Azure DevOps
- Hands-on experience with SSIS (package development, deployment and maintenance)
- Working knowledge of Power BI, including troubleshooting performance and access issues
- Familiarity with monitoring tools such as SCOM and/or Azure Monitor
- Experience using ServiceNow or similar ITIL-based ticketing systems
